Stockport Homes: From System Crisis to Successful Procurement

Read time: 3 Min

Housing system procurement and public sector compliance

The Challenge
Stockport Homes needed to replace their core housing management system as part of a wider transformation programme. Their old system was no longer fit for purpose and navigating public procurement rules added pressure to an already complex change process.

The Approach
We led the procurement process from brief to contract award:

  • Held discovery sessions with IT, housing and finance leads to understand core pain points

  • Created a compliant two-stage tender process with tailored award criteria

  • Facilitated supplier presentations, scoring moderation and contract finalisation

What We Delivered

  • End-to-end procurement process design and management

  • Specification drafting and evaluation model development

  • Stakeholder engagement and process documentation

  • Contract negotiation support and supplier debriefs

The Result
Stockport Homes procured a modern, user-friendly system that supports their operational goals. The process was completed on time and within budget, with internal teams feeling confident and informed throughout.
